As much as I personally would like to add/enhance this environment mod, there's currently no documentation for the lua API (for almost a year now) to make my own cargo system and adding more cargo types with individual locations with the way it's currently working (I just hook into the vanilla container system) is very cumbersome and doesn't allow for much customization, like individual rewards, time limits (think critical medical cargo) etc.
I'm also no longer actively playing the game since there's too many undocumented changes breaking stuff (like the crab fishing spots, pump throughput) and every other update requires to restart a career save due to new blocks or other additions not carrying over to existing savegames for whatever reason.
I appreciate your input and will consider it in case things might change for the better, heh.

Not without a few changes, since I'm just hooking right into the vanilla container system, so I'm currently unable to change delivery payouts, research points or other ways to reward the player, since the vanilla container system doesn't provide this functionality.
